Repairing Your Daewoo Washer: Common Issues and Solutions
Daewoo washers are generally reliable appliances, but likeall machines, they can encounter problems over time. Don't fret! Many common Daewoo washer issues can be easily fixed.
Here's a list of some frequent issues and their possible solutions:
* **Washing Machine Won't Start**
Check| the power cord is securely inserted into both the wall outlet and the washer. Make sure the circuit breaker hasn't flipped.
* **Excessive Noise During Operation**
Check for loose objects inside the drum, such as coins or buttons. Ensure the wash drum is properly balanced and not packed too full.
* **Leaking Water**
Inspect the door gasket for damage. Check| any hoses connecting to the washer, such as the water inlet and drain hose.
* **Clothes Aren't Getting Clean**
Ensure you're using the correct cleaning agent for your laundry type. Modify| the wash cycle settings for heavier soils or examine| adding a pre-wash step.
* **Drainage Problems**
Clear any clogs| in the drain hose or pump filter.
If these solutions don't resolve the problem, it's best to contact a qualified Daewoo washer repair person.
